Overview
TaxJar is a cloud-based sales tax compliance platform that calculates sales tax at checkout, tracks economic nexus across US states, and can auto-file state returns on a business's behalf. It integrates directly with major e-commerce and marketplace platforms and has been owned by Stripe since 2021, serving 20,000+ businesses.
The problem TaxJar solves
E-commerce sellers who cross economic nexus thresholds in multiple US states must register, calculate, collect, and file sales tax separately in each state — a process involving dozens of different rates, filing deadlines, and state tax portals that quickly overwhelms a small finance team. TaxJar solves this by calculating accurate US sales tax at checkout through its API and pre-built platform integrations (Shopify, Amazon, WooCommerce, etc.), monitoring nexus thresholds automatically, and, on paid plans, auto-filing the actual state returns — so sellers don't have to manage 20+ state filings by hand.

Best for
- US-based e-commerce sellers on Shopify, Amazon, WooCommerce, or BigCommerce needing automated multi-state sales tax calculation and filing
- Small-to-midsize online retailers tracking economic nexus thresholds across many states who want AutoFile to handle state returns directly
- Businesses that want a straightforward, self-service tax tool rather than a heavily consultative enterprise deployment
Not a fit if
- Businesses selling internationally that need VAT/GST calculation or multi-currency tax support (TaxJar is US-only by design)
- Enterprises with complex, highly customized exemption-certificate workflows requiring deep configurability (better served by enterprise-grade tools like Avalara)
Why it’s listed
- TaxJar has been Stripe's dedicated sales-tax product since Stripe acquired it in 2021, and it's one of the most established self-serve options for e-commerce sellers managing economic nexus across US states.
- It plugs directly into the major channels sellers already use — Shopify, Amazon, BigCommerce, WooCommerce, and more — rather than requiring a separate integration project.
- AutoFile actually files the state returns, not just calculates the tax, which is the step most competitors leave to the customer.
Pricing
Starter
$39 per monthEntry plan for smaller sellers needing basic multi-state tax reporting.
- Up to 3 data import integrations
- Email support with guaranteed response time
- 2 AutoFile credits/year ($50 for additional filings)
- Simple and advanced CSV import
- Jurisdiction-level sales tax reporting
- 10 team users
Professional
$99 per monthFor growing sellers needing nexus monitoring and dedicated support.
- Up to 10 total integrations (data import + API combined)
- Email and phone support with guaranteed response time
- Dedicated onboarding and Customer Success Manager
- 4 AutoFile credits/year ($55 for additional)
- Economic nexus dashboard and alerts, audit support
- 10,000 API calls/minute, 10 team users

Pros & cons
Pros
- Simple, user-friendly interface — reviewers consistently cite quick setup and navigation compared to competitors
- Significant time savings on multi-state tax management; one G2 reviewer reported saving 20+ hours/month tracking nexus across 27 states
- Seamless integrations with major sales channels (Shopify, Amazon, WooCommerce) enable consolidated, cross-channel tax reporting
- AutoFile automates the actual state return filing, not just calculation
Cons
- Support quality has reportedly declined since the 2021 Stripe acquisition — reviewers describe offshore support and slower, multi-day response times on filing-deadline-sensitive issues
- Pricing has risen sharply — Starter plan doubled from $19 to $39/month in 2026, and AutoFile fees increased too
- Lacks tax-exempt certificate capture and offers limited ability to manually adjust calculations for complex exemption scenarios
- US-only: no VAT/GST calculation or currency conversion, so international sellers must look elsewhere
What we found
G2 rates TaxJar 4.7/5 across 249 reviews, with corroborating scores of 4.4/5 on Capterra (76 reviews) and 8.1/10 on TrustRadius (23 reviews). Reviewers consistently praise the simple setup and multi-channel integrations, but describe support quality declining since the 2021 Stripe acquisition and note the Starter plan doubled in price from $19 to $39/month in 2026.
